The Significance of the Banda Sea: Tectonic Deformation Review in Eastern Sulawesi Titu-Eki, Adept; Hall, Robert
Indonesian Journal on Geoscience Vol 7, No 3 (2020)
Publisher : Geological Agency

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.17014/ijog.7.3.291-303

Abstract

DOI:10.17014/ijog.7.3.291-303The geology of eastern Sulawesi is widely known for its complexity due to multiple deformation stages.The geology on land has been studied excessively, but little assessment has been made on the offshore geology, thus the geological evolution of the area remains a subject of controversy. A thorough observation of high multibeam bathymetry dataset offshore and SRTM dataset onshore provides an understanding on the geological features relating to the tectonic deformation. Exquisite morphological features include carbonate buildups and gravitational collapse dominating the shelf areas whereas distinct form of ridges and seamount exists in the offshore. Structural features in this area including the major Tolo Thrust and South Sula Fault varied structural lineations on land with several polygonal extensional faulting and accretionary wedge on the west of the North Banda Sea. The existence of these features may indicate that the area was majorly deformed during Neogene, specifically relating to the opening of the Banda Sea due to the subduction rollback of Banda.

HIDROGEOLOGI DESA FATUMONAS DAN SEKITARNYA, AMFOANG TENGAH, KABUPATEN KUPANG Noni Banunaek; Adept Titueki
Jurnal Teknologi Vol 15 No 2 (2021): Nopember 2021
Publisher : Universitas Nusa Cendana

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| Full PDF (112.039 KB)

Abstract

Desa Fatumonas dan sekitarnya terdapat di Kecamatan Amfoang Tengah Kabupaten Kupang, Berdasarkan Peta Geologi Rosidi HMD, dkk 1979, terdiri dari satuan batuan Kompleks Bobonaro dan Formasi Aitutu (Tra). Berdasarkan hasil pengamatan lapangan ternyata di Desa Fatumonas dan sekitarnya pada daerah airtanah langka tidak merupakan Kompleks Bobonaro, banyak dijumpai mataair yang ekonomis. Ini membuktikan adanya kesalahan penarikan batas atau pemetaan geologi yang dilakukan pada 32 tahun lalu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ui dan memetakan geologi detail permukaan serta memetakan hidrogeologi dan mataair di Desa Fatumonas dan sekitarnya. Metode penelitian yang digunakan meliputi melakukan kajian hasil pemetaan sebelumnya, pengambilan data citra satellite serta Pegamatan dan pemetaan dan lokasi mataair dan sumur gali. Hasil pengukuran debit mataair dan sumur gali. potensi air di daerah Fatumonas dan sekitarnya dapat hadir dalam bentuk; (1) kontak antara batugamping TRPml dan lempung TRa, dimana air keluar melalui rekahan batugamping (2) jalur sesar/patahan pada batuan gamping (TRPml) (bahkan juga di Formasi Aitutu), (3) tanah hasil pelapukan batuan sedimen TRa, dan (4) alluvium. Pengoptimalan potensi air tanah dapat dilakukan melalui pemboran atau sumur gali dangkal, sedangkan potensi mata air (spring) dapat dioptimalkan dengan membangun tampungan (reservoir) serta penjaringan pipa ke arah pemukiman.
PENERAPAN IPTEK KEPADA KELOMPOK PEMILAH MANGAN DI KABUPATEN KUPANG Yusuf Rumbino; Herry Zadrak Kotta; Fani K. Y. Serangmo; Rizhard Ndolu; Noni Banunaek; Woro Sundari; Aisyah Ahmad; Adept Talan Titu Eki; Ika Fitri Krisnasiwi; Andreas Sinuhaji
Jurnal Pengabdian Kepada Masyarakat Vol 2 No 2 (2022): Desember 2022
Publisher : Universitas Nusa Cendana

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ar

Abstract

Masyarakat di Desa Ekateta Kecamatan Fatuleu Kabupaten Kupang. Ada yang memiliki pekerjaan sebagai pemilah batuan yang mengandung logam mmangan (Mn). Para pekerja merupakan penduduk desa yang dilibatkan oleh suatu perusahaan yang memiliki Ijin Usaha Tambang (IUP) untuk memisahkan mangan dari batuan pengikutnya dengan cara “hand sorting”. Para pekerja ini tidak dilengkapi peralatan K3 maupun fasilitas dalam memilah mangan. Jumlah pekerja tidak menentu tergantung banyaknya tumpukan mangan yang digali oleh alat berat perusahaan. Permasalahan utama dari para pekerja adalah mereka tidak dapat memilah batuan mangan yang berukuran kurang dari 2 cm karena selain lebih mudah mengumpulkan batuan mangan yang berukuran lebih besar dari 5 cm. Metode kegiatan berupa penyampaian materi mengenai teknis penambangan mangan, K3 dalam usaha pertambangan, perhitungan ekonomis yang didapatkan jika bisa mengambil mangan yang berukuran kurang dari 2 cm menggunakan alat bantu mekanis berupa trommel screen dan log washer. Dampak dari kegiatan pengabdian ini adalah menimbulkan motivasi para pemilah untuk bermitra dengan kampus dalam menghasilkan prototipe alat yang bisa digunakan sebagai pemilah mekanis untuk mendapatkan batuanpembawa mangan yang berukuran kurang dari 2 cm.
CORRELATIONS OF PHYSICAL-MECHANICAL PROPERTIES OF THE BOBONARO CLAY IN TIMOR, AND ITS IMPLICATIONS IN GEOTECHNICAL WORK: KORELASI DAN IMPLIKASI GEOTEKNIK TERHADAP SIFAT KUAT GESER LEMPUNG BOBONARO DI TIMOR Adept Titu-Eki; Nugraha K. F. Dethan
INTAN Jurnal Penelitian Tambang Vol. 6 No. 1 (2023): INTAN Jurnal Penelitian Tambang
Publisher : Jurusan Teknik Pertambangan Program Studi S1 Teknik Pertambangan Fakultas Teknik Pertambangan dan Perminyakan Universitas Papua

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.56139/intan.v6i1.172

Abstract

Many geotechnical problems like slope failures and other infrastructure damage are common in civil and mining projects on the Bobonaro Clay Complex in Timor. Obtaining relevant geotechnical data for a complete engineering analysis is often time-consuming and expensive. Therefore, a study on the relationship between the parameters can be a powerful tool in these situations. Here we used multiple linear regression analysis to determine the correlation between the physical properties (clay content and plasticity index) and mechanical properties (angle of internal friction and cohesion) of the Bobonaro Clay. The data are 53 clay samples from Kupang, East Nusa Tenggara Province. These samples were from geotechnical drilling and Atterberg tests, grain size–hydrometer analysis, and unconsolidated–undrained Triaksial tests. Of all the correlation attempts, we found that only the clay content – plasticity index, and clay content – angle of internal friction exhibited a moderate correlation with a positive trend. The results of the multiple linear regression correlation also failed to express a good model; therefore, it was replaced by simple linear regression analysis. The various factors that need to be considered in a geotechnical correlation study, along with the significance and uniqueness of the Bobonaro clay, are also addressed in this article.
